As the Assistant SENCO at this primary school, you will work closely with the SENCo to support the co-ordination of SEND across EYFS, KS1 & KS2.
You will help in identifying pupils requiring additional support and assist with the implementation and reviews of support plans as well as contributing to the EHCP process and annual reviews.
You will work alongside class teachers and support staff to promote inclusive classroom practice and ensure that pupils with SEND are supported both academically, physically and emotionally.
